Output 58900b1ef1640863e331eb51a0a1e125c63c657f91c8fabdddff15eac4aa8afb:1

value
571280
script pubkey
OP_0 OP_PUSHBYTES_20 ff2481c559ea27aefc1d52e9bb4188eec36f9aaf
address
ltc1qlujgr32eagn6alqa2t5mksvgampklx40pz63al
transaction
58900b1ef1640863e331eb51a0a1e125c63c657f91c8fabdddff15eac4aa8afb
spent
true